Arthur W. Pink has held various pastorates in the United States. He has been engaged in Bible conference work in the United States, Australia, and other countries and resided in Scotland up until the time of his death, July 15, 1952. Pink was the author of various books and booklets on Bible exposition, as well as the editor and publisher of a Bible study magazine, Studies in the Scriptures.
Pink answers a host of questions that have remained unresolved in the minds of many Christians. In language that any layperson can understand, he takes up the profoundest questions, searches the Scriptures, and provides Biblical answers that satisfy the inquiring mind.
